More about event planner courses in Adelaide

Embarking on a career in event planning can be incredibly rewarding, especially in vibrant cities like Adelaide, where opportunities abound for skilled professionals. The Event Planner courses in Adelaide equip learners with essential skills to excel in this dynamic industry. One notable option is the Diploma of Hospitality Management SIT50422, which provides comprehensive training tailored for those with prior experience seeking to elevate their careers. By enrolling in this advanced course, you will gain valuable insights that can open doors to various job roles within the events sector.

Upon completion of Event Planner courses in Adelaide, graduates can explore a range of exciting career paths. You could pursue a position as an Event Manager, responsible for overseeing all aspects of event execution, or perhaps an Events Assistant, playing a crucial role in supporting larger event operations. Other potential opportunities include becoming an Event Coordinator or a Conference Coordinator, where your organisational skills will be key to delivering successful events that leave lasting impressions.

The event planning landscape in Adelaide is rich with opportunities, ranging from large-scale conferences to intimate gatherings, all of which require adept coordinators and managers to bring them to life. Beyond the courses, aspiring professionals can also consider advanced roles such as Function Coordinator, Conference Manager, or even an Event Director. If you have a flair for creativity, you might find excitement in becoming an Event Stylist or a Festival Producer. Moreover, positions like Ticketing Coordinator offer yet another avenue for you to thrive in this exhilarating field.
